Buldak Craze: Hype or Worth It?

Have you noticed how Buldak Creamy Carbonara is trending everywhere right now? Shops like Anti Gutom Cravings Club and Anesi Shop sell it for ₱150+, even though you can grab the same pack at the grocery for just ₱70. They’ll claim it’s about “convenience” or “plating,” but honestly, it’s still instant noodles dressed up to look fancy. The hype is strong, especially since everyone’s craving this popular dish, but the value doesn’t always match the price. Some buyers even say it ends up watery or bland, making the steep markup feel even worse. At the end of the day, you’re not really paying for better taste but you’re paying for the trend.
